Northern Station Newsletter sa nfranciscopol ice. org Sun Francisco -•• - ];''1 Police Deportment (IIII11111111 1U['Di '•- IL' Captain Joe Engler's Message Residents, Merchants, and Visitors, Active and ongoing communication between law enforcement and community members is a key feature of "community policing" and a critical ingredient in the effectiveness of your officers at Northern Police Station. The Northern District embraces a strategy using foot-beat officers in the several commercial corridors of its neighborhoods. Foot patrols cast our officers in the most traditional of police roles. These officers are in direct contact with the public at almost all times and are in the best position to learn about the neighborhood's problems and the path to real solutions. Captain Joseph Eng!er Currently, the following listed officers are contributing to our safe streets and neighborhoods by walking a foot-beat. Officer Matt Horn is the new Hayes Valley/Haight Street beat. Officers Paul Wilgus and Cliff Burkhart walk the beat in Japantown and the Upper Fillmore. Officer Brian Donohue and Calvinn Wang are adept problem solvers in the Lower Polk Street corridor. Officer Nate Bernard peddles the hills and alley ways in the Upper Polk Street neighborhood. Officer Stephen Horn has endeared himself to the Union Street merchants and residents as he returns to his Cow Hollow beat. Sibling Officers Shyrle and Nico Hawes have signed up for the Divisadero Street and Chestnut Street foot beats and will be working closely with businesses to abate the recent spate in shoplifting and car break-ins. Officers Dennis Cesena and Mike Chantal will continue their foot beat duties around the Civic Center and City Hall footprint. -

Extending Success: Streetcars to Ft. Mason Rick Laubscher, Doug Wright, Rich Hillis SPUR, October 19, 2011 Historic Streetcars: Huge SF Success ! “Trolley Festival” started Trolley Festival, 1983 momentum 28 years ago ! Used Market St. surface track ! Chamber-City joint project ! Mayor Feinstein was champion ! Community support led to: ⊕" 5-summer run ⊕" Adoption of permanent F-line F-line, Pier 39, 2000 ! F-line open 1995; to Wharf 2000 ! Today: 23,000+ daily riders ⊕" Most popular vintage line in U.S. ⊕" Service increased to meet demand ⊕" Still more service needed Rail’s Role: Commerce, Commuters, Defense Ferry Bldg. 1927 ! Waterfront rail – 1900-c.1960s ⊕" State Belt freight RR served piers ⊕" Supplies, troops carried to Fort Mason & Presidio on Army track ⊕" 25 streetcar lines served waterfront ♦"World’s 2nd busiest transit hub ! Maritime & defense evolved ⊕" Waterfront’s face changed forever ⊕" Today: recreation, visitor oriented Troop Train at Crissy Field 1941 Fort Mason Streetcar History ! Muni’s H-line served Fort Mason 1914-1948 Fort Mason Streetcar Revival ! Historic waterfront streetcar line repeatedly proposed ⊕" 1970: San Francisco Tomorrow suggests waterfront route ⊕" 1979: First Muni Embarcadero streetcar proposal included in plan ⊕" 1980: GGNRA General Management Plan proposes historic streetcar shuttle from Aquatic Park to Crissy Field ⊕" 1985: I-280 Transfer Study evaluates Caltrain-Fort Mason route ⊕" 2000: F-line extension opens to Wharf ⊕" 2001: Fort Mason Center, Fisherman’s Wharf Merchants, Market Street Railway -
